What is the VELYS Robotic-Assisted Solution?

The VELYS Robotic-Assisted Solution is a modern surgical tool that helps surgeons perform knee replacement procedures with high accuracy. While robotic-assisted technology is often associated with automation, it's important to clarify that the VELYS system does not operate independently. Instead, it works as a precision-guided assistant controlled entirely by the surgeon.

The VELYS system provides surgeons with the information they need to make data-driven decisions during surgery through advanced imaging, real-time feedback, and specialized tracking tools. Its primary role is to assist in:

  • Assessing a patient's unique knee anatomy
  • Enhancing precision when removing damaged bone
  • Supporting accurate alignment and positioning of the implant
The result is a tailored surgical experience that may help some patients achieve improved outcomes.

How Does the VELYS Robotic-Assisted Solution Work?

The VELYS system is designed to integrate advanced tools and technologies that optimize the surgical process seamlessly. Here's how it works:
  1. Gathering Real-Time Data:
    During surgery, the VELYS system uses an infrared camera and optical trackers to collect real-time information about the patient's knee anatomy. The data obtained allows the surgeon to better understand the joint's structure and alignment, creating a roadmap for precise surgical adjustments.
  2. Supporting Precision with Surgeon Guidance:
    With the data collected, the VELYS system aids the surgeon in removing damaged bone and preparing the knee joint for an implant.
  3. Enhancing Implant Positioning:
    Accurate placement of a knee implant is critical to its long-term success. The VELYS system provides real-time feedback that helps the surgeon align and position the implant with high precision, tailored to the patient's unique knee structure.
  4. Working with the ATTUNE™ Knee System
    The VELYS Robotic-Assist Solution is specifically designed to work alongside the ATTUNE Knee System, a proven knee replacement implant used globally. The ATTUNE system aims to support natural motion and recovery, making it an ideal partner for the VELYS technology.
It's important to emphasize that the surgeon remains in complete control throughout the procedure, using the VELYS tools to refine decisions and enhance precision.

Key Features of the VELYS Robotic-Assisted Solution

The VELYS system offers a combination of technologies that set it apart in the realm of robotic-assisted surgery:
  • Infrared Imaging: An advanced infrared camera provides continuous feedback, helping surgeons understand the patient's knee in real-time.
  • Optical Tracking: Specialized trackers monitor the patient's movements and anatomy to help the surgical plan align with the patient's unique needs.
  • Data-Driven Adjustments: The system delivers insights supporting real-time decision-making, allowing the surgeon to adjust for precise outcomes.
  • Surgeon-Controlled Assistance: The VELYS system acts as a guided tool rather than an autonomous robot, relying on the surgeon's experience at the center of the procedure.
These features allow the surgeon to focus on delivering personalized care with the help of modern technology.

What Makes the VELYS System Unique?

Unlike other robotic-assisted systems, the VELYS Robotic-Assisted Solution is designed to work seamlessly with the ATTUNE™ Knee System. The combination of the two systems helps optimize the knee replacement experience by uniting precision technology with a proven implant system.

Additionally, the VELYS system prioritizes real-time decision-making. Rather than relying solely on pre-operative data, the system continuously gathers insights during the procedure. This real-time feedback allows the surgeon to adjust to achieve precise alignment and positioning.
